Sat 1375380607522505

decimal
340152.607522505
degree
0°130152′1464″607522505‴
percentile
65.49431471597259%
name
eckxqxfmyyq
cycle
0
epoch
1
period
168
block
340152
offset
607522505
timestamp
rarity
common
inscriptions
location
a7ca2e59850a1f444ac168583fc638d7e4fbd41bb81ab017fe0882bab70c0fed:0:2016306317
address
3FuhQLprN9s9MR3bZzR5da7mw75fuahsaU